Why mandelic acid is gentler
Mandelic acid has a larger molecular structure, so it penetrates more slowly. That slower penetration typically means less irritation and a more predictable response—especially for reactive skin.
What mandelic acid helps with
- Uneven texture and dullness
- Visible roughness from dead-cell buildup
- Skin that reacts easily to strong actives
